This view shows the list of all diagnostic tests that are currently running or were already terminated on the member devices of the group. It can be filtered to reduce the list either by Execution Status or by Diagnostic Result. The table provides the following details on the tests:

Parameter

Description

Name

The name of the device on which the diagnostics were executed.

Status

Displays the progress of the diagnostic execution.

Diagnostic Result

These fields show if the diagnostics were executed successfully or if they failed.

Description

This column lists all test that were run by the diagnostic.

Create Time

The date and time at which the object was originally created.

Last Modification Date

Displays the date and time at which the selected object was modified for the last time; for folders this field remains empty.

Right-clicking an entry allows you to go to the selected entry by selecting the Go To item of the appearing pop-up menu or by double-clicking the entry. The focus of the console will be moved to the selected device under the Devices node.

Changing the update manager

f you need to define another device as the Update Manager, proceed as follows:

  1. Click Change Update Manager.
    The Change Update Manager window displays.
  2. Select the new Update Manager from one of the available lists.
  3. Click OK.

The selected device is now the new Update Manager. The focus of the console moves to the Update Manager view of the device. There you can ensure that it is up to date by checking for later versions and if required updating the components.

Checking for available updates

To verify if updates are available for one or more of the components, proceed as follows:

  1. Click Check for Update.

A verification is launched via the Internet to check for available updates.

  • If none are found only the Last Verification date box above the table is updated with the date and time of this operation.
  • If one or more updates are available this information is presented as follows:
    • The icon color of the Last Verification box changes to either yellow (update available for at least one component) or red (updates available for all components).
    • The value of the Status box of the respective component changes to Out of Date.
    • The color of the Status icon changes to yellow or red.

Local update manager status

To locally verify the status of the Update Manager , proceed as follows:

  1. Go to the Device Topology > Your Update Manager > Agent Configuration > Module Configuration > Update Management node.
  2. Select the Update Status tab.

This view displays the following information about the current status of the Update Manager:

Parameter

Description

Component

The fields of this column list all components of which the automatic update can be managed by the Update Manager .

Version

This field displays the currently installed version of the respective component.

Status

This field displays the current status of the component, that is, if the component is of the latest available version ( Up to Date ) or if it needs to be updated ( Out of Date ). Any type of failed status, such as Download Failed , License expired will be displayed via a red flag. During the update process this field will also display the different stages of the process until all components are up to date.

Available Version

After a check was executed and updates are available for individual components this field will indicate their version number.

Updating the components

After a verification indicated that updates are available for at least one component, proceed as follows:

  1. Click the arrow next to Status Update all Components and select which components to update. You have the following options:
    • Update All Components to update all components for which an updated version is available.
    • Update Security Products and Virtualization (before v12) to update only the security products and the virtualization modules or
    • Update Software Catalog to only update the software catalog.
  2. The update process is launched.
    1. The available updates for the selected components are downloaded.
    2. The value of the Available Version changes to the version number of the version that was just downloaded.
    3. The installation process of the components is started.

After the update process is finished, the value of the Version box changes to that of the Available Version , the status will change to Up to Date, the icon turns green again and the Last Update Time changes to the current date and time value.

Any type of failed status, such as Download Failed , License expired will be displayed via a red flag. During the update process this box will also display the different stages of the process until all components are up to date.
